Commit 3d728ea1 authored by Volker Krause's avatar Volker Krause

Preserve calendar product ids when loading ical data

parent 5e4efa68
......@@ -133,6 +133,7 @@ private Q_SLOTS:
calendar.reset(new KCalCore::MemoryCalendar(QTimeZone()));
KCalCore::ICalFormat format;
QVERIFY(format.fromRawString(calendar, inFile.readAll()));
} else if (inputFile.endsWith(QLatin1String(".eml")) || inputFile.endsWith(QLatin1String(".mbox"))) {
mimeMsg.reset(new KMime::Message);
......@@ -209,7 +209,9 @@ void ExtractorEnginePrivate::setContent(KMime::Content *content)
#ifdef HAVE_KCAL
m_calendar.reset(new KCalCore::MemoryCalendar(QTimeZone()));
KCalCore::ICalFormat format;
if (!format.fromRawString(m_calendar, content->decodedContent())) {
if (format.fromRawString(m_calendar, content->decodedContent())) {
} else {
